Commit 6519df8f authored by Lars Ingebrigtsen's avatar Lars Ingebrigtsen

Make fully qualified domain names more fully qualified

* lisp/gnus/message.el (message-make-fqdn): Don't try to use a
system-name without any periods as a fully qualified domain name.
parent b74d536e
......@@ -5778,7 +5778,10 @@ give as trustworthy answer as possible."
(not (string-match message-bogus-system-names message-user-fqdn)))
;; `message-user-fqdn' seems to be valid
message-user-fqdn)
((not (string-match message-bogus-system-names sysname))
;; A system name without any dots is unlikely to be a good fully
;; qualified domain name.
((and (string-match "[.]" sysname)
(not (string-match message-bogus-system-names sysname)))
;; `system-name' returned the right result.
sysname)
;; Try `mail-host-address'.
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ment